Bristol's Demographic Profile

Bristol has 25,935 households and a median income of $74,600, providing context for rent absorption and tenant demand across retail and multifamily assets. A 0% five-year population trend is a key signal for evaluating long-term demand in this market.

Key Demographic Metric Value
Population 61,572
# Households 25,935
Median age 42
Median household income $74,600
Avg household size 2.0
Renter-occupied housing units 10,019
5-year population change 0%
